Mumbai is lined with many statues of people who made Mumbai what it is. Now forgotten, they line up the footpaths of Mumbai, jostling for space with the illegal hawkers in the city

Sir Hormusjee Cowasjee Dinshaw was a philanthropist who gave lots of money in charity to build hospitals and schools
